Emerson vs. University of Dallas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Emerson or University of Dallas?

  • Emerson College is 17.2% more expensive to attend than University of Dallas for in-state tuition ($52,288.00 vs. $44,630.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 17.2% higher at Emerson than University of Dallas ($52,288.00 vs. $44,630.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of Dallas than Emerson ($27,250 vs. $51,432)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Dallas are 41.4% lower than costs at Emerson College ($13,810 vs. $19,528)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at University of Dallas than Emerson College (100% vs. 78%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by University of Dallas students is 48.7% larger than aid received Emerson College ($36,231 vs. $24,360)

Emerson vs. University of Dallas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Emerson or University of Dallas?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between University of Dallas or Emerson .

  • The average SAT score at University of Dallas (1217) is 6 points higher than at Emerson (1211)
  • Incoming Emerson students have at the same average ACT score (27) as students at University of Dallas (27)
  • Accepted freshman University of Dallas students have a 0.17 point higher average high school GPA (3.9) than students at Emerson (3.73)
  • University of Dallas has a higher acceptance rate (58.7%) than Emerson (42.7%)

Emerson vs. University of Dallas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Emerson or University of Dallas?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between University of Dallas and Emerson.

  • The graduation rate at Emerson is higher than University of Dallas (81% vs. 73%)
  • Graduates from Emerson College earn on average $1,200 more per year than University of Dallas graduates after ten years. ($49,200 vs. $48,000)
  • Emerson College students graduate with a $500 lower median federal student loan debt than University of Dallas graduates. ($23,500 vs. $24,000)
  • Emerson graduates are paying $6 less per month on federal student loans than University of Dallas graduates. ($242 vs. $248)
  • More Emerson gra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former University of Dallas students, three years after graduation. (80% vs. 77%)
